For a long time now, we have wanted to build a small play structure for the kids out back. We wanted something that would encourage imagination and, well, be different. Since I’m an aerospace engineer my wife suggested we build an airplane. I knew this was going to be tough. I wanted to design a plane that was fairly simple and could be built in a weekend. The problem was actually making it look like a plane and yet still be an easy build. In case you didn’t know, airplanes have pretty complex surfaces. Nonetheless, after a couple design iterations I think we nailed it. But tell me what you think in the comments.
